MON-544 - Remove kubernetescluster tag

This commit is contained in:
Jérémy MARMOL 2019-12-12 12:01:03 +01:00
parent c3b8517f15
commit 24a36b63d2

View File

@ -5,7 +5,7 @@ resource "datadog_monitor" "disk_pressure"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es_state.node.disk_pressure"${module.filter-tags.service_check}.by("kubernetescluster","node").last(6).count_by_status() "kubernetes_state.node.disk_pressure"${module.filter-tags.service_check}.by("node").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-36,7 +36,7 @@ resource "datadog_monitor" "disk_out"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es_state.node.out_of_disk"${module.filter-tags.service_check}.by("kubernetescluster","node").last(6).count_by_status() "kubernetes_state.node.out_of_disk"${module.filter-tags.service_check}.by("node").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-67,7 +67,7 @@ resource "datadog_monitor" "memory_pressure"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es_state.node.memory_pressure"${module.filter-tags.service_check}.by("kubernetescluster","node").last(6).count_by_status() "kubernetes_state.node.memory_pressure"${module.filter-tags.service_check}.by("node").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-98,7 +98,7 @@ resource "datadog_monitor" "ready"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es_state.node.ready"${module.filter-tags.service_check}.by("kubernetescluster","node").last(6).count_by_status() "kubernetes_state.node.ready"${module.filter-tags.service_check}.by("node").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-129,7 +129,7 @@ resource "datadog_monitor" "kubelet_ping"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es.kubelet.check.ping"${module.filter-tags.service_check}.by("kubernetescluster","name").last(6).count_by_status() "kubernetes.kubelet.check.ping"${module.filter-tags.service_check}.by("name").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-160,7 +160,7 @@ resource "datadog_monitor" "kubelet_syncloop" {
type = "service check" type = "service check"
query = <<EOQ query = <<EOQ
"kubernetes.kubelet.check.syncloop"${module.filter-tags.service_check}.by("kubernetescluster","name").last(6).count_by_status() "kubernetes.kubelet.check.syncloop"${module.filter-tags.service_check}.by("name").last(6).count_by_status()
EOQ EOQ
thresholds = { thresholds = {
@ -217,7 +217,7 @@ resource "datadog_monitor" "node_unschedulable" {
query = <<EOQ query = <<EOQ
${var.node_unschedulable_time_aggregator}(${var.node_unschedulable_timeframe}): ${var.node_unschedulable_time_aggregator}(${var.node_unschedulable_timeframe}):
sum:kubernetes_state.node.status${module.filter-tags-unschedulable.query_alert} by {kubernetescluster,node} sum:kubernetes_state.node.status${module.filter-tags-unschedulable.query_alert} by {node}
> 0 > 0
EOQ EOQ
@ -250,8 +250,8 @@ resource "datadog_monitor" "volume_space" {
query = <<EOQ query = <<EOQ
${var.volume_space_time_aggregator}(${var.volume_space_timeframe}): ${var.volume_space_time_aggregator}(${var.volume_space_timeframe}):
avg:kubernetes.kubelet.volume.stats.used_bytes${module.filter-tags.query_alert} by {kubernetescluster,name,persistentvolumeclaim} / avg:kubernetes.kubelet.volume.stats.used_bytes${module.filter-tags.query_alert} by {name,persistentvolumeclaim} /
avg:kubernetes.kubelet.volume.stats.capacity_bytes${module.filter-tags.query_alert} by {kubernetescluster,name,persistentvolumeclaim} avg:kubernetes.kubelet.volume.stats.capacity_bytes${module.filter-tags.query_alert} by {name,persistentvolumeclaim}
* 100 > ${var.volume_space_threshold_critical} * 100 > ${var.volume_space_threshold_critical}
EOQ EOQ
@ -285,8 +285,8 @@ resource "datadog_monitor" "volume_inodes" {
query = <<EOQ query = <<EOQ
${var.volume_inodes_time_aggregator}(${var.volume_inodes_timeframe}): ${var.volume_inodes_time_aggregator}(${var.volume_inodes_timeframe}):
avg:kubernetes.kubelet.volume.stats.inodes_used${module.filter-tags.query_alert} by {kubernetescluster,name,persistentvolumeclaim} / avg:kubernetes.kubelet.volume.stats.inodes_used${module.filter-tags.query_alert} by {name,persistentvolumeclaim} /
avg:kubernetes.kubelet.volume.stats.inodes${module.filter-tags.query_alert} by {kubernetescluster,name,persistentvolumeclaim} avg:kubernetes.kubelet.volume.stats.inodes${module.filter-tags.query_alert} by {name,persistentvolumeclaim}
* 100 > ${var.volume_inodes_threshold_critical} * 100 > ${var.volume_inodes_threshold_critical}
EOQ EOQ